Salmon ring, a simple and easy recipe from Marché Bonichoix!

Ingredients

  • 500 white wine ml
  • 680 salmon g
  • To taste, salt and pepper
  • 30 butter ml
  • 1/2 red onion
  • 180 cream cheese ml
  • 125 plain greek yogurt ml
  • 30 lemon juice ml
  • 30 cilantro ml
  • 30 dill ml
  • 300 smoked salmon g

Directions

  1. 1

    In a saucepan, bring wine to a boil. Add salmon. Season with salt and pepper. Bring again to a boil.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er about 5 minutes or until salmon is cooked. Keep 30 mL (2 tbsp.) of cooking liquid. Drain salmon and refrigerate until cold, about 30 minutes.

  2. 2

    In a skillet, melt butter over medium heat. Add red onion and cook 10 minutes or until tender. Add reserved cooking liquid and continue cooking until evaporated. Transfer to a bowl and refrigerate until completely cold.

  3. 3

    Flake chilled fish with a fork. Add red onion mix and remaining ingredients and mix to combine. Adjust seasoning as needed.

  4. 4

    Line a 1 L (4 cup) round pan with plastic wrap. If using, cover edges with smoked salmon slices. Add salmon mixture and press down with a spoon to flatten. Cover and refrigerate at least 4 hours, then turn ring over onto a serving dish.
